The Regulatory Studies Center, in partnership with the National Security Commission on Emerging Biotechnology (NSCEB), convened experts to discuss how the U.S. can revise its biotechnology regulatory system to improve the industry’s competitiveness and accelerate commercialization of new products, all while maintaining safety and public trust for the general public.
The Regulatory Studies Center co-hosted a conference with Norm Ai July 8, 2025 exploring the challenges and opportunities for artificial intelligence to streamline regulatory compliance burdens and improve stakeholder experiences with government services.
Former U.S. Senator Phil Gramm (Texas) and George Mason University economics professor Donald Boudreaux shared insights and explored the transformative power of free markets in a discussion of their new book which challenges prevailing narratives about capitalism.
